
Analyzing the pathology and immunological antibody detection of Peste des petits ruminants in Lincang City, Yunnan Province, 2021—2023

Objectives To comprehensively grasp the immune effect of small ruminant plague in Lincang City and scientifically evaluate its infection status. Methods 4 524 serum samples and 1 000 eye and nose cotton swabs of sheep from large-scale farms and free-range households were randomly collected from 2021 to 2023. Blocking ELISA method was used to detect antibodies against Peste des petits ruminants (PPR). The fluorescence RT-PCR of viral nucleic acid was used to detect the pathogen of PPR. Results The qualification rate of immune antibodies against PPR in 2022 was 7.44 percentage points higher than that in 2021, and that in 2023 was 3.11 percentage points higher than that in 2022. No positive samples of PPR virus nucleic acid were detected with pathology. Conclusions Lincang City has focused on various measures of prevention and control including 'prevention human from infecting animal diseases, and moving the keypoints forward', and the immune effect of small ruminant plague is good in general.
